GREAT WOMEN OF TOMORROW BURSARY [ENDOWED]

This needs-based bursary supports families committed to an independent school education but for whom the tuition of an unsubsidized school is out of reach.
Established in 2024 by the Claudine and Stephen Bronfman Family Foundation and The Molson Foundation, this initiative reflects their enduring dedication to our school.
